Transaction 164ee504933d7de64d55392b5177d65c5792dcad9b81242c56e663ff04952897

1 Input
2 Outputs
  • 164ee504933d7de64d55392b5177d65c5792dcad9b81242c56e663ff04952897:0
  • value  6323260
    address  1B9fXhKhTe9Vt2bjKbeSPoQyCwEowH7dnk
  • 164ee504933d7de64d55392b5177d65c5792dcad9b81242c56e663ff04952897:1
  • value  215762
    address  1Kmc1Kz3Dvin8EtLEqJmdDWpjGtwTUGe2c